She is the quiet in the shadows; a thief haunting the dreams of the Clan.

Ever since she came into existence - for no dragon can really say she was born - she has been a plague on others. She is not a Plague elemental herself, though. But this may be the reason for her appearance, for her blood-eyes, her dark colouring. She was not born under the watch of the Plaguebringer like an ordinary Plague dragon - but nevertheless, she took the shape of one, emerging in a form which she hoped that others would recognize, and perhaps even accept.

It did not work out as well as she hoped. Her form was defined by the thoughts and perceptions of others; the others, who only knew her through the nightmares she brought, decided she was to look like the enemy. She would have changed her appearance herself if she had any control over it, but unfortunately that was not possible. While others did recognize her, and even accept her - it was clear that they saw her as a threat.

She couldn’t tell if that was what she wanted, or if she only became so because that was what they told her.
Cinnabari is not sure how she came to live in the northern rain forest, or how she joined the spirits of the Clarus Clan; but to her, this is home. There is something about the Willow that feels right, proper.

She is not a loud presence in the Clan. In fact, most of the Clan doesn’t even know she’s there - they cannot see her. She tends to stay out of the way, focused mostly on her work, and sometimes, focused on avoiding her work. Some of those who are in similar alignment with her will accompany her throughout the day, although she never speaks with them, even if she does enjoy their company. She merely soaks up their presence, and they understand that she will not — cannot — speak to them directly without danger. There is no way for her to communicate without bringing destruction to those around her. Nightmares spew from her maw, the most intimate fears of her companions coming to fruition in her thoughts, spiraling to reach anyone in the vicinity without holding back, uncontrollable attacks on the subconscious of everyone - death and disease - falling and failure - broken hearts and the loss of loved ones - destruction of all that a dragon knows - never-ending nightmares…

There are few exceptions to her unbidden attack on the psyche. Over the course of her existence, Cinnabari has noticed that those from the spirit world only feel her dream plagues when she wishes to harm them; those of the Sidhe courts feel only a nagging itch in the back of their thoughts no matter how hard Cinnabari tries to reach their minds. Her closest friend, Shock, is neither of these beings and so Cinnabari needs to more careful with him. But he is not a dragon either, and so she is not nearly as dangerous to him as she is to others.

The dragons of the Clarus Clan do not notice her like the spirits and Sidhe do. But she prefers it that way. They have inadvertent allowed her to settle beside many other non-dragons; they have not pushed her away like many other Clans have. Cinnabari is protective of these kind, naive dragons, too welcoming for their own good. Some might call them stupid - and those are the ones Cinnabari attacks with her dream plagues.

While the Clarus dragons do not know she is there, and most of the spirits and Sidhe leave her be, Shock will follow Cinnabari around the lair. When Cinnabari is asleep, Shock watches over her nest, waiting for her corporeal form to reappear when she is finished in the dreamworld.

In return, she helps Shock with his task of controlling and spreading his mother’s disease, providing him with the Plague magic he requires in order to survive. Together, the two work to balance and protect one another. There is a strange, cooperative relationship between the two, and they have even hatched a few broods together. They cannot nest in the nursery under Carina's watchful eye, because the nursery caretaker despises the Clarus Clan non-dragons - whom she calls imposters. And so Cinnabari and Shock hide their eggs from the other dragons.

There is only one dragon in the Clarus Clan who is aware of Cinnabari’s precense, although he has only noticed her in the dream world. Jassu is the Clan’s dream-keeper, and so he has noticed a strange current in the Clan’s dreams, a reoccuring energy which has developed slowly over the course of seasons. Jassu has no name to put to it, but it is Cinnabari whom he feels. She knows that the Skydancer will soon find her, and she fears of what may happen when that time comes. She does not want to haunt him or the Clan - but she cannot always control how her dream plagues affect others.
